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
When it pertains to exercise bikes, there are mainly 3 types: upright bikes, recumbent bikes, and indoor cycling bikes (also referred to as spin bikes). Each type deals with various fitness levels, choices, and advantages.
| Type | Description |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Upright Bikes | These resemble standard bicycles and need the user to sit upright. | General fitness; those who enjoy standard cycling positions. |
| Recumbent Bikes | These include a larger seat and back assistance, enabling users to recline a little. | Individuals with back issues; senior citizens; those seeking convenience during workouts. |
| Indoor Cycling Bikes | Developed for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and energetic cycling. | Physical fitness enthusiasts; users trying to find intense exercises or classes. |
Selecting the Right Bike for Your Needs
When selecting the finest exercise bike, consider the list below elements:
Budget: Exercise bikes come in numerous price varieties. Identify how much you want to invest before checking out alternatives.
Area: Measure the location where the bike will be placed to guarantee it fits comfortably. Some designs are foldable or compact for smaller sized spaces.
Adjustability: Look for a bike with adjustable seats and handlebars to accommodate various body types and choices.
Resistance Levels: Different bikes offer differing levels of resistance. Choose one that lines up with your fitness goals, whether you choose gentle exercises or intense training sessions.
Show Features: A great display screen can track metrics like time, distance, speed, calories burned, and heart rate. Consider what details is very important for your exercises.
Guarantee and Customer Service: Ensure that the bike comes with a service warranty and that the maker has excellent customer care in case you require assistance.
Benefits of Using Exercise Bikes
Stationary bicycle offer many advantages, that make them an important addition to any fitness regimen:
1. Convenience and Accessibility
Having a bike at home enables for exercise at any time without the need to travel to a fitness center. This convenience can substantially increase the likelihood of preserving a constant exercise schedule.
2. Low Impact
Exercise bikes supply a low-impact workout, which is gentler on the joints compared to strolling or running. This makes them suitable for people recovering from injuries or with joint problems.
3. Cardiovascular Health
Biking is an exceptional way to increase heart rate and enhance cardiovascular fitness. Routine use of a stationary bicycle can result in enhanced endurance and total heart health.
4. Weight Management
Incorporating biking into a physical fitness program can support weight-loss and management by burning calories effectively.
5. Engage Multiple Muscle Groups
While mainly targeting the legs, exercise bikes also engage core and upper body muscles when utilized correctly.
6. Flexibility in Workouts
With alternatives to adjust resistance and speed, stationary bicycle offer versatility in workout strength, supplying opportunities for a variety of fitness levels from novices to innovative athletes.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How often should I use a stationary bicycle for optimum results?
For maximum advantages, go for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ity aerobic activity or 75 minutes of vigorous-intensity activity every week. This might be divided into sessions on the stationary bicycle, spread over several days.
2. Can I utilize an exercise bike for weight reduction?
Yes! Constant biking can help burn calories, contributing to weight-loss when integrated with a well balanced diet plan.
3. Is it safe to use a stationary bicycle every day?
Cycling daily can be safe for the majority of people, however it's essential to listen to your body. Incorporate day of rest or differ exercise intensity to prevent overuse injuries.
4. What are some typical errors to avoid while using an exercise bike?
Common mistakes include incorrect seat height, poor posture, and not heating up before starting a workout. Guarantee correct alignment and change the bike settings for your convenience.
